How to Get Into Yale Law School

To be competitive at Yale Law School, applicants typically present a LSAT score near 174 (middle 50%: 171–177) and a GPA around 3.96 (3.90–4.00). Yale Law School admits about 4.06% of applicants. Each entering class is roughly 175 students. The school is located in New Haven, CT. Figures reflect the 2025 entering class. Yale Law School: Frequently Asked Questions

What is Yale Law School's acceptance rate?

Yale Law School has an acceptance rate of about 4.06% (2025 entering class). For comparison, the average across Law programs we track is 30.0%.

What LSAT score do you need for Yale Law School?

Admitted students at Yale Law School have a median LSAT score of 174, with a middle-50% range of 171 to 177 (2025 entering class). A score at or above the median makes you most competitive.

What GPA do you need to get into Yale Law School?

The median GPA of admitted students at Yale Law School is 3.96, with a middle-50% range of 3.90 to 4.00 (2025 entering class).

How much does Yale Law School cost?

Annual in-state or resident tuition at Yale Law School is $76,636. Tuition figures exclude living expenses and fees.

How hard is it to get into Yale Law School?

Admission to Yale Law School is competitive: it admits roughly 4.06% of applicants, the median LSAT is 174, the median GPA is 3.96. Applicants near or above these medians have the strongest odds.
